Implants for a younger smile
Many people are considering dental implants as a way to preserve the
youthful appearance of their face. Human bones are living tissue and
stimulation of the jawbone is important when it comes to maintaining a young
face. Chewing with natural teeth produces pressure that stimulates the jawbone.
This stimulation of the bone keeps the jaw bone for eroding or shrinking and
giving our face an older and wrinkled appearance. Beyond keeping a youthful
smile, dental implants allow a patient to enjoy full function of the teeth
working properly.
Unlike dentures, implants can last a lifetime. They are surgically
placed in the jaw bone, providing stimulation and restoring full function to
our ability to chew. Dental implants are as effective as our natural teeth
because they mimic the root and the crown of our natural teeth. The root is a
tiny titanium screw that fuses to the bone. The crown is a perfect match with
the shape and color of our natural teeth. In addition, dental implants are not
affected by tooth decay.
